The true innovators of psy-trance have reached a new peak with this cutting-edge release. After a decade of relentless touring all over the globe and constant reinvention in the studio, they've amassed a fiercely loyal audience -- and those who've experienced the band's six prior albums and been infected by their revelatory live shows have learned to expect the unexpected. This is Infected Mushroom's 7th studio album, 2 years since the release of their critically acclaimed "Vicious Delicious" album. "Legend Of The Black Shawarma," the title for this much anticipated album, takes a step further in their 15 year musical journey and is by far their best work to date. The album took two years to record, and it reveals just how diversified, yet dedicated to their own agenda Infected Mushroom continue to be. The story of the legend unfolds and reveals Infected Mushroom's stand out creative story telling, “It was originally going to be a concept album about food we are addicted to,” says Amit “Duvdev” Duvedevani of electronic-rock phenoms INFECTED MUSHROOM about the group’s latest album, Legend of the Black Shawarma. “We had a batch of songs celebrating our favorite places to eat around the world. Then we got into more intense subject matter, but as the title suggests, there’s still a lot of material about getting your grub on.” The lead single “Smashing the Opponent” features a scorching vocal from Korn’s Jonathan Davis, while Jane’s Addiction/Porno for Pyros frontman and alternative-rock patron saint Perry Farrell lends his inimitable pipes to the follow-up single , “Killing Time.” “Recording with Jonathan and Perry was a highlight, of course,” Duvdev notes. “They were both incredibly cool. The fact that they liked the tracks was awesome because we’re huge fans of what they do.” Thanks to their boundary-pushing songs and incendiary performances, the adventurous duo has become one of the biggest electronic bands on the planet. Twice ranked among the world’s 10 best DJs by the bible of the scene, the U.K.’s DJ magazine, they routinely whip crowds of all cultures into the same whirling froth. Their explosive show, featuring guitars, live drums, Duvdev’s intensely passionate vocals, Erez’s nimble keyboards and an ambitious multimedia backdrop, ranks among the genre’s most unpredictably joyous events. The recordings of the album were supervised by Paul Oakenfold whose imprint, Perfecto-Records, will release the album in the US through Rocket Science, a home for Prodigy and Crystal Method, just to name a few. HOMmega Productions, a 2nd home for Infected Mushroom, will release this massive album internationally and deliver it to the worldwide markets.
